资源简介:
The aim of this experiment is to test how atypical codon assignment (in our case Ser and Leu at CUG sites) flexibility can provide an effective mechanism to alter the genetic code. We have reengineered C. albicans strains to mis-incorporate increasing levels of Leu at protein CUG sites.
